Understanding the inputs required by the calculator is crucial for accurate calculations. The following elements are foundational to the proper functioning of the Gemini 4:

  1. Total Budget: Input the overall budget available for allocation. This figure represents all the available financial resources that you can distribute among various projects.

  2. Expected Return on Investment (ROI): For each initiative under consideration, enter the anticipated ROI. The ROI is generally represented as a percentage and indicates the profitability of an investment relative to its cost. This input helps prioritize projects.

  3. Project Duration: Specify how long each project is expected to take. The duration impacts cash flow and may affect resource allocation if a project takes longer or shorter than expected.

  4. Risk Assessment: Rate each project's risk level (low, moderate, high). Understanding the risks involved will guide how much funding is allocated to different initiatives. Risk is often inversely related to how much budget should be dedicated to any given project.

  5. Resource Availability: Include any constraints on resources, whether financial (cash flow issues) or physical (manpower, materials). Assessing availability helps ensure that resource allocations are realistic and achievable.

  6. Market Conditions: Lastly, recent data on current market conditions and trends should be entered. This input will adjust calculations to reflect real-world circumstances influencing project viability.

How to Interpret Results

Upon entering the necessary inputs into the Gemini 4 calculator, the output will provide allocations for each project alongside a projected ROI. Understanding how to analyze these results is essential for making informed financial decisions.

  • High ROI Values: A project that yields a high ROI (typically upwards of 15-20%) indicates a preferable investment opportunity. These projects should generally attract more funding, as they promise substantial returns.

  • Low ROI Values: Conversely, projects with low or negative ROI should either be re-evaluated or allocated minimal funds. Projects with expected returns below zero signify a loss of investment and may require additional scrutiny to ascertain if they can be modified or scrapped altogether.

  • Balanced Allocation: The output may also show a recommended percentage of the total budget for each project. Projects with varying risk levels will often see different levels of funding based on the estimated ROI and their risk profile. Projects with high returns but low risk are ideal candidates for a more substantial allocation.

  • Adjustments for Market Conditions: If you observe that the market conditions are changing, use this insight to revise your allocations. For example, if there’s an upward trend in a specific sector, allocate more resources there, as the calculator will likely recommend.
